* Name: Hamilton Heights
* Location: The townhomes are located on a bluff on Hamilton Avenue, just to the east of North Market and four blocks from Frazier Avenue. The development is zoned for Red Bank Elementary, Middle and High schools, and is walking or biking distance from Greenlife Grocery, Coolidge Park and downtown Chattanooga.
* Status: Six total townhomes have been built; two are occupied, and two are in the final stages of construction.
* Price: Townhomes run from $349,000 to $399,000 for square footage ranging from 2,057 to 2,348 on three floors. Units are equipped with either two or three bedrooms, and either 21⁄2 or 31⁄2 baths.
* Features: Granite countertops, birch doors, maple floors and matching maple cabinets are lit by natural sunlight and protected by a full sprinkler system. Bosch appliances, a central vacuum system and two-car parking are available. Five porches with patios offer different viewing angles of the countryside, while recessed lighting inside contributes to the open and airy atmosphere.
* Amenities: Townhomes include extras like gas grill-ready patios, built-in wine racks, 10-foot ceilings and a high-efficiency insulation package, in addition to being on the North Shore.
* Developer: David Jones
* Builder: Collier Construction
